The Immediate Cascade: What Stops Working in the First 72 Hours

Within moments of a total grid failure, modern life grinds to a halt in ways most people have never considered. Traffic signals go dark across every city, creating immediate gridlock and accidents at intersections. Gas stations—even those with fuel in their underground tanks—cannot pump without electricity, stranding motorists wherever their tanks run dry.

Municipal water systems depend on electrically-powered pumping stations. When these fail, water pressure drops to zero within hours. No water flows from faucets for drinking, cooking, or sanitation. Sewage treatment plants, equally dependent on electrical power, cease processing waste. Backup generators at these facilities might buy a few extra days, but without fuel resupply—which won't happen without functioning transportation—they'll eventually fall silent too.

Communication Breakdown

Radio stations, television broadcasts, cell towers, and internet service providers all require continuous electrical power. While many have backup generators, these are designed for short-term outages—not extended grid failure. Within days, virtually all electronic communication ceases. You won't be able to call 911, check news updates, or contact family members in other locations. This information blackout compounds every other challenge, as people have no way to coordinate, receive instructions, or understand the scope of what's happening.

Commercial Infrastructure Failure

Grocery stores operate on just-in-time inventory systems, typically stocking only about three days' worth of products. Fresh items like produce, dairy, and meats often arrive daily. Without electricity, refrigeration fails immediately. Perishable inventory begins spoiling within hours. Cash registers won't function, credit card processing becomes impossible, and electronic inventory systems go offline.

Even if store owners wanted to sell or distribute their remaining stock, they'd face impossible logistical challenges. Most would lock their doors, hoping power returns quickly. When it becomes clear that restoration isn't imminent, desperate crowds will take matters into their own hands. The empty shelves you've seen during minor emergencies are nothing compared to what happens when society realizes food resupply isn't coming.

The Four Waves of Grid-Down Casualties

Research from governmental commissions studying electromagnetic pulse scenarios has projected that approximately 90 percent of the American population could perish within the first year following a complete, extended grid failure. This staggering figure isn't hyperbole—it reflects the systematic analysis of how interdependent modern society has become with electrical infrastructure. Understanding each wave of casualties helps preparedness-minded individuals identify which threats to prioritize.

First Wave: Medical Dependency

The first casualties in any extended grid-down scenario will be those dependent on daily medications and electrical medical equipment. Over 130 million Americans require prescription medications to manage chronic health conditions—roughly 66 percent of all adults in the country. Many of these medications require refrigeration, and the supply chains that deliver them depend entirely on functioning infrastructure.

Diabetics requiring insulin face life-threatening situations within days when refrigeration fails and pharmacy supplies run out. Those on dialysis, oxygen concentrators, or other electrically-powered medical devices face immediate crises. Cardiac patients dependent on specific medications may have only a limited supply on hand.

Second Wave: Disease and Sanitation Collapse

Within weeks of grid failure, disease becomes a mass killer. When municipal sewage processing stops, waste begins backing up through the system. People without alternative sanitation plans will resort to disposing of human waste wherever they can—often contaminating the same water sources they depend on for drinking, cooking, and bathing.

Human waste contains dangerous pathogens that spread rapidly through populations with compromised sanitation. Cholera, typhoid, dysentery, and other waterborne diseases—largely eliminated in developed nations through modern infrastructure—return with devastating force. Without functioning hospitals, diagnostic equipment, or medication supplies, medical professionals become nearly helpless against spreading epidemics.

Third Wave: Starvation

The largest and most prolonged wave of casualties comes from starvation. Approximately 83 percent of Americans live in urban and suburban areas with no meaningful food production capacity. Most households maintain minimal food reserves—perhaps a week's worth of groceries at best. When stores empty and resupply becomes impossible, hundreds of millions of people face the same question: where does the next meal come from?

Food stored in freezers begins thawing within 24 hours without power. Most people lack the knowledge or equipment to preserve meat through smoking, salting, or canning. They'll consume what they can before it spoils, then face rapidly dwindling options. Canned goods and shelf-stable foods provide temporary relief, but typical household inventories measure in days or weeks—not the months required to establish alternative food sources.

Even those who recognize the need to grow food face enormous challenges. Modern agricultural productivity depends heavily on petroleum-powered equipment, chemical fertilizers, and irrigation systems—none of which function without the broader infrastructure. Returning to manual farming techniques produces far less food per acre and requires far more labor. The transition period, lasting at least one full growing season, would see mass starvation before locally-grown food could fill the gap.

Practical Steps You Can Take Today

The scope of grid-failure preparedness can feel overwhelming, but every journey begins with single steps. Here's a practical progression for building genuine resilience:

Immediate priorities (this week): Audit your current supplies. How many days could your household survive without leaving home or receiving outside assistance? Most families discover the honest answer is far shorter than they'd assumed.

Short-term goals (this month): Establish minimum 30-day supplies of shelf-stable food and stored water. Acquire basic water purification capability. Ensure you have backup lighting and power for essential devices.

Medium-term objectives (this quarter): Expand food storage toward 90-day minimums. Develop solar charging capabilities. Build out comprehensive first aid supplies. Acquire and learn to use backup communication equipment.

Long-term development (this year): Work toward one-year food storage. Install meaningful solar power generation. Develop food production skills through gardening. Build relationships with like-minded neighbors. Acquire security capabilities appropriate to your situation.
